Determination of residual organic solvents in 2-2-methyl-4-2-4-(trifluoromethyl) phenyl pyrimidin-4-yl methylsulfanyl phenoxy acetic acid by capillary gas chromatography / 中国药学杂志
Chinese Pharmaceutical Journal ; (24): 562-564, 2013.
Article in Chinese | WPRIM | ID: wpr-860432
ABSTRACT

OBJECTIVE:

To establish a capillary GC method for the determination of residual solvents including ethanol, acetoni-trile, acetone, isopropanol, ethyl acetate, dioxane and THF in 2-[2-methyl-4-[[2-[4-(trifluoromethyl) phenyl] pyrimidin-4-yl] methylsulfanyl] phenoxy] acetic acid.

METHODS:

The residual organic solvents were separated on DB-1capillary column (30 m × 0.53 mm, 5.00 μm). FID was used as detector with a temperature of 250°C, and the inlet temperature was 160°C. The carrier gas was nitrogen, and the column temperature was programmed set. The contents of residual solvents were calculated by external standard method.

RESULTS:

The seven residual organic solvents were completely separated, the recovery rates and linear relationship were good, and three batches of samples all met the requirements.

CONCLUSION:

The method is simple, accurate, and reproducible, so it can be used for the detection of seven residual organic solvents in the raw.
